PAUL’S dad Denny sent shockwaves through Coronation Street tonight – leaving his son vomiting with drunken antics before issuing a chilling threat.

Last month, it was revealed the ITV soap had signed up former Emmerdale actor Danny Cunningham to play Paul and Gemma’s abusive dad.

Coronation Street viewers got their first glimpse of him during Monday’s episode, when he heard Paul talking about his MND battle on the radio.

But tonight he arrived on the Cobbles seeking out ex-wife Bernie Winter, who was shocked to see him suddenly in front of her.

Trying to get rid of him as quickly as possible, Bernie lied and told Denny that Paul was already dead, and that the radio interview had been pre-recorded.

But Denny soon found out the truth as he turned up at Paul’s flat before begging his son to go for a chat over a cuppa.

However, that was code for pint, as he took Paul to the Rovers where he started knocking back the drinks.

Paul also indulged in some booze and the tension soon eased between them.

But after Paul accidentally knocked a drink over and the glass smashed on the floor, landlady Jenny Connor suggested it was time to go home.

Once back at the flat with his dad, Paul’s husband Billy and Bernie were shocked to see him drunk, before berating Denny for getting him into such a state.

Denny tried to brush their criticism off, insisting he was just helping his son have fun while he still could, but then Paul vomited on himself, causing concern for his mum and husband.

Denny made a quick exit, but going after him, Bernie demanded: “Why have you come crawling out of the woodwork all of a sudden?”

Her ex insisted it was so he could spend time with his son while he still had the chance, but she wasn’t buying it at all.

She said: “You see the thing is, I know you…”

But she was stopped in her tracks as Denny viciously interrupted as he came towards her and said: “And I know you, a lot better than Paul and Gemma do, obviously.

“Now they might think I’m a terrible parent but I’ve got nothing on you.”

He continued: “Oh actually, I have got something on you, and we wouldn’t want that to get out would we?”

He then put his finger to his lips and made a ‘sssh’ sound before adding: “Like I said, it’ll be a quiet one tomorrow.”

He then walked off, and Bernie looked rattled, leaving Coronation Street fans to wonder just what exactly Denny had on her that she didn’t want her kids to know.
